Radionuclide Dosimetric Data Sheets

Lanthanum-135
Isotope: La-135
Atomic number (Z): 57
Mass number (A): 135
Neutron number (N): 78
Decay modes: β+, Electron capture
Half-life: 19.5 [h]
Decay constant: 9.8739e-06 [1/s]
Daughters: Ba-135 (100.0%)
Radioactive daughters: None
Mean alpha energy: 0.0 [MeV]
Mean electron energy: 0.00669 [MeV]
Mean photon energy: 0.03607 [MeV]
Air kerma rate constant, Γ10: 4.177e-18 [Gy·m2/Bq·s]
Air kerma coefficient, Kair: 4.180e-18 [Gy·m2/Bq·s]
Equilibrium dose constant for weakly-penetrating radiations (α and/or
electrons), Δwp: 1.072e-15 [Gy·kg/Bq·s]
Equilibrium dose constant for alphas, Δα: 0.000e+00
[Gy·kg/Bq·s]
Equilibrium dose constant for betas/electrons, Δβ-,β+,e-:
1.072e-15 [Gy·kg/Bq·s]
Equilibrium dose constant for photons, Δp: 5.779e-15
[Gy·kg/Bq·s]
